Article: Boxer keeps seat by defeating Fong in Senate contest: Davis elected next governor in California.(Nation)(Elections '98)

LOS ANGELES - California Democrats Gray Davis and Barbara Boxer gave the national Democratic Party its biggest triumph of the election season, with early returns and exit polls indicating they won the governor's seat and the U.S. Senate race by large margins.

A strong turnout among Hispanics and women was the key to both triumphs - along with a seeming public indifference to the White House sex scandal.

Both President Clinton and first lady Hillary Rodham Clinton raised large amounts of money for Mr. Davis, the state's lieutenant governor, and Mrs. Boxer, spending 13 days in the state since Labor Day.
